Disability shower installation services focus on creating accessible bathing environments that accommodate individuals with mobility challenges or other physical limitations. These services typically involve replacing standard showers with features such as low-threshold or walk-in designs, grab bars, non-slip flooring, and adjustable seating. The goal is to enhance safety and independence in the bathroom, making it easier for users to enter, exit, and use the shower comfortably and securely. Professionals ensure that the installation meets specific accessibility standards and integrates seamlessly with existing bathroom layouts.
This service addresses common problems faced by individuals with limited mobility, such as difficulty stepping over high tub edges or maintaining balance on slippery surfaces. It helps reduce the risk of slips, falls, and injuries that can occur in traditional shower setups. Additionally, disability shower installations can alleviate caregiver concerns by providing safer, more manageable bathing options. These modifications also support aging in place, allowing seniors or those with disabilities to maintain their independence without the need for frequent assistance.

Installation Costs - The typical cost for installing a disability shower ranges from $1,500 to $5,000, depending on the complexity and materials used. Basic models may be on the lower end, while customized features can increase the price.
Material Expenses - The price of materials for a disability shower can vary from $500 to $2,500. Options include accessible tiles, grab bars, and waterproof flooring, with higher-end materials costing more.
Labor Fees - Labor costs for installing a disability shower generally fall between $1,000 and $3,000. The total depends on the project's scope and the local contractor rates in Monroe, MI.
Additional Features - Adding features such as seating, hand-held shower heads, or custom fixtures can increase overall costs by $500 to $2,000. These enhancements are often tailored to individual accessibility needs.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What should I consider when installing a disability shower? It is important to evaluate accessibility features such as grab bars, non-slip flooring, and appropriate shower height to ensure safety and ease of use.
Can I install a disability shower in my existing bathroom? Yes, many local service providers can adapt existing bathrooms to include accessible shower options, depending on space and structural considerations.
How long does a disability shower installation typically take? Installation times can vary based on the complexity of the project, but most installations are completed within a day or two by qualified contractors.
Are there different types of disability showers available? Yes, options include roll-in showers, walk-in showers, and shower stalls with built-in seating, tailored to individual needs and preferences.
